I wasn't able to get anywhere with the main web site in Safari with VoiceOver 
on.  Not only does the site use flash for its contents, but the source page 
view indicates that they are using a lot of javascript.  I couldn't even click 
in the web page and select all to send the contents to TextEdit for viewing via 
the services menu option.

What did work was doing a Google search for a separate page for Red Mango gift 
cards.  I found this URL for their online card sales:
https://redmango.myguestaccount.com/login/web_card_sale/selectcards.srv

I think this is the page you can eventually get to if you manage to get past 
all the flash and javascript.  Navigate to the Quantity field of the 
denomination gift card you want ($25, $50, $75, etc.), route your mouse cursor 
to your VoiceOver cursor with VO-Command-F5 and click with VO-Shift-Space in 
the text field.  Then type the number of cards you want and press return.  
You'll be taken to the Billing & Shipping page, and can continue.  I didn't try 
to go through the whole order placement, but this seemed to work with Safari 
and VoiceOver once you get past that main web page.  I'd normally try to find a 
search field or sitemap link on the main page to do a search, but it didn't 
work in this case, so I tried Google.  So the workaround in this case was to 
search for the specific web page on the redmango.com site that dealt with gift 
cards, and hope that if I found this that it wouldn't have the same flash 
problems of the main page of the site.
